**Handover: Connection pooling in the Plugbase SDK**

Hey plugin folks — quick note before I roll off. The Plugbase SDK now manages its own Postgres pool (default 10 connections per plugin), so please stop opening raw connections in your init hooks; you'll starve everyone else. Pool settings live in the plugin manifest. The migration guide covers edge cases. Questions or weird pool exhaustion errors go to the maintainer below.

approver of kawig-fahof = Wenvan Prair

## Ownership: Static-Analysis Baseline

The file `baseline.lintstate` pins known findings for the Quarrel analyzer so new warnings fail CI while legacy ones do not. Do not regenerate it casually; a full regen hides real regressions. Updates require a short note in the sync agenda explaining which findings were cleared and why. Merge rights on this file are restricted to a single maintainer, whose full name appears below.

named custodian: Oliath Ralax

TICKET-4821: Webhook retries misfiring in Quillbrook staging. The staging environment was cloned from prod without updating retry semantics, so failed deliveries to Pondera endpoints retry every 2s indefinitely instead of exponential backoff capped at 6 attempts. Fix lands in delivery-worker v3.2; review the backoff config change. Staging also needs the signing secret re-set, so add this line to .env.staging:

sealed setting: VAULT_KEY20=c8ea1e419912889df6b4

Context: Orvano is splitting the monolith's user module into the new Keldway service. Plugin authors: stop calling legacy user endpoints by end of quarter. Use the Keldway SDK; auth tokens from the monolith won't carry over. Migration order: profiles, sessions, preferences. Breakage during cutover windows is expected — check the status board before filing reports. Sandbox accounts reset weekly. To restore your sandbox credentials after a reset, enter the recovery passphrase shown below.

strongbox words: gilok-druion-briath-wendor-briion-prawyn-fenion-oliir-casdor-holius-briius-gilath-gilael-pelys